Police seek public assistance after body find at sea

Lautoka Police is requesting assistance in identifying the body of a man, found floating in waters off the Varale Reef between Lautoka and Naviti Island  Yasawa, yesterday.

The body was found by a group of divers from Lautoka, and recovered by officers from WATERPol and Crime Scene Investigators.

The victim, believed to be a male i-Taukei, has a tapa design tattoo on his elbow and was wearing a brown t-shirt and navy blue shorts.

Please call Crime Stoppers on 919 or the Western Division Command Center on 9905457 if you have any information that can assist in identifying the victim.
